Output 578a6ccfd72abaf1dad30a67a331b3d36dc30266d76174bd58f1690b57515d45:19

value
989900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7863a24aaa0860da64f37b389e50c5814a4c12fc OP_EQUAL
address
3CfaNFZ6ahdps9WeTEERFjV5spC7Z4cYrW
transaction
578a6ccfd72abaf1dad30a67a331b3d36dc30266d76174bd58f1690b57515d45
spent
true